Dr. Khyati Shrivastav is presently working as Assistant Professor in the Department of Electronics & Communication Engineering, School of Engineering & Sciences at G D Goenka University, Sohna road, Gurugram, Haryana. She received her PhD degree in Electronics and Communication Engineering from Visvesvaraya National Institute of Technology, Nagpur, India in 2020.

During her PhD work, she carried out research on Wireless Sensor Networks for Internet of Things based on scalability and heterogeneity for energy efficient applications. She has authored 12 research papers in peer reviewed International (SCI, Scopus, UGC-Listed) Journals as well as International and National Conferences. She has also authored Springer book chapter on AI integration with WSN-IOTs.

She won the prize for Best Paper Presentation in International Conference UPCON-16, IIT-BHU,Varanasi. Two papers were awarded as Best papers in National Conference NCACESM-2019, CU,Punjab. She has presented paper in Third IEEE International Conference CODIT-17, held at Barcelona, Spain. She has Qualified GATE-2010 in ECE and UGC-NET- 2025 in Electronic Science. Her Foreign visits include Paris, France and Barcelona, Spain. She has received Gargi Award for Distinction in class Xth from Balika Shiksha Foundation, Govt of Rajasthan. She has Certificate of Excellence by Deptt of Telecommunication Engg, Dayananda Sagar College of Engg, Bengaluru for performance in MTech examination held by VTU in 2012. She has Certificate for securing A+ Grade in C, C++ & MS-Office and Internet language.She has done her B.Tech Internship and project in RRSSC, ISRO, Jodhpur, Rajasthan.

Her areas of interest are Wireless Sensor Networks, Internet-of-Things (WSN-IoT), Artificial Intelligence (AI),Machine Learning (ML), Embedded Systems, Networking, 5G/6G for Communication etc. She has received MHRD Scholarships for pursuing Full-time MTech as well as PhD with teaching assistantship. She has completed NPTEL FDP online certificate on Advanced Wireless Communication. Dr. Khyati, did her M. Tech in Digital Communication and Networking (DCN) from Dayananda Sagar College of Engineering, Bengaluru & Visvesvaraya Technological University (VTU), Belgaum, Karnataka ,India in 2012 and B.Tech in Electronics and Communication Engineering (ECE) From Mody Institute of Technology & Science (MITS), Laxmangarh, Rajasthan, India in 2010.
